Driveway trench repair services involve fixing the designated channels or grooves cut into a driveway to manage water runoff and prevent erosion. These trenches are typically dug alongside or across the driveway to direct rainwater away from the surface, helping to keep the driveway dry and stable. When these trenches become damaged or improperly maintained, they can lead to water pooling, soil erosion, and even structural issues for the driveway. Skilled service providers can assess the condition of existing trenches and perform necessary repairs to restore proper drainage and protect the driveway’s integrity.

Many common problems signal the need for trench repair. Over time, trenches may develop cracks, become clogged with debris, or suffer from erosion that causes them to collapse or lose their effectiveness. Heavy rain, poor initial construction, or shifting soil can contribute to these issues. If water begins to pool on the driveway surface or at its edges, or if there are noticeable dips or uneven areas along the trench lines, it may be a sign that repairs are needed. Addressing these problems promptly can help prevent more extensive damage, such as cracked pavement or foundation issues, saving property owners from costly repairs later on.

Professionals offering driveway trench repair typically evaluate the existing drainage system, identify areas of damage or blockage, and perform targeted repairs. This can include patching cracks, regrading trenches for better water flow, or installing new drainage channels if needed. The goal is to improve water management around the driveway, reduce the risk of erosion, and extend the lifespan of the paved surface.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or trench repairs in driveways range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, covering patching or sealing small sections. Fewer projects reach into the higher end of the spectrum.

Moderate Repairs - more extensive trench work or partial driveway repairs usually cost between $600-$1,500. These projects often involve replacing sections or addressing underlying issues, with costs varying based on size and complexity.

Full Replacement - replacing an entire driveway trench can range from $2,000-$5,000 or more. Larger, more complex projects with additional site prep tend to approach the higher end of this range.

Complex or Large-Scale Projects - very extensive repairs or full driveway replacements with added features can exceed $5,000. Such projects are less common and typically involve significant excavation, materials, and labor costs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es driveway trenches to form? Driveway trenches often develop due to soil erosion, poor drainage, or ground shifting beneath the surface, which can lead to cracks and uneven areas.

How can driveway trench repair improve driveway stability? Repair services typically involve filling and leveling trenches to restore the driveway's surface, helping to prevent further damage and maintain its structural integrity.

Are there different repair options for driveway trenches? Yes, local contractors may use methods such as patching, sealing, or reconstructing sections of the driveway, depending on the severity and size of the trenches.

What signs indicate that driveway trench repair might be needed? Visible cracks, uneven surfaces, pooling water, or worsening trenches are common signs that professional repair services could be beneficial.

How do local service providers handle driveway trench repairs? Contractors assess the damage, prepare the area, and utilize appropriate materials and techniques to fix trenches and restore driveway functionality.
